[QUOTE=tontoz]Orlando Dwight wouldn't even make 3rd team All-NBA in MJ's era. I would take Shaq, Zo, Hakeem, Drob and Ewing over him easily.[/QUOTE]
Not every single season. Hakeem missed the All-NBA Team in 1992. Brad Daugherty made it ahead of him (and Hakeem didn't miss games). Daugherty is flat out not as good as Howard.
Zo missed the All-NBA Team in 1998, with both Hakeem and Ewing missing much of the season. Dikembe made it ahead of him and Dikembe is flat out not as good as Howard. Even in 97, Shaq missed a bunch of time and Robinson missed all but 6 games. Howard in 2011 would have made that team ahead of O'Neal. He would have made the 1st team.
